NXT Title: Kevin Owens vs. Zack Ryder

We even get big match intros. Owens is all over him to start but a single forearm sends him out to the floor. Ryder is right back on him but Owens knocks Zack into the barricade. Back in and Ryder scores with a middle rope dropkick but the Pop Up Powerbomb ends this in 1:12.

Owens gives him the Cannonball and another powerbomb post match.

King Barrett vs. Ryback

Ryback still has bad ribs coming in. Barrett is thrown around to start and planted with an early powerslam but he rolls outside. Ryback follows but takes a hard kick to the ribs to give the King control. Back in and some kicks to the ribs followed by a middle rope elbow get two. Wasteland gets the same as Barrett wisely stays on the ribs. The Bull Hammer takes too long to set up though, allowing Ryback to hit a spinebuster and the Shell Shock for the pin at 3:56.

Rating: D+. So Barrett just spent the entire match working on the ribs and then Ryback hit his power moves like he was perfectly fine. Nothing to see here other than yet ANOTHER Barrett loss, which just keep coming and coming and coming. This was another match designed to set up the Chamber but with no time to get there because we need more stupid soap opera nonsense.

King Barrett vs. Dolph Ziggler

No entrance for the King. Dolph tries to take him to the mat to start and gets a boot and headbutt to the face for his efforts. The Stinger Splash and neckbreaker put Barrett down and the bit elbow drop gets two. Barrett comes right back with his spinning suplex out of the corner for two and Dolph is in trouble.

Back from a break with Ziggler fighting out of a chinlock but missing another Stinger Splash. Wasteland gets two and Barrett takes Dolph outside for a toss into the barricade. They head back inside and a boot to the face gets two but the Bull Hammer is countered by a superkick to the arm. The Zig Zag connects on the staggered Barrett for the pin at 8:02. Another day, another clean loss for Barrett.
